From Love Island and Married at First Sight and from Made in Chelsea to The Only Way is Essex, reality TV shows make me want to scream louder than an Islander who finds a locust in their cocktail.

Presenter Nick and his team of heroes put real into reality show

Add to the list Strictly, I'm A Celebrity... Get Me Out of Here and Big Brother, all are vanity, veneer, vacuity and a virulent desire for fame/more fame.

Whether it's Maya Jama, Claud and Tess or Ant and Dec, the presenters are interested only in themselves, their egos bigger than a house.

The antithesis of all that - putting the real into reality show-is DIY SOS. The rebuild-a-home-in-days show has muck, mess heart and soul.

The opener to the 34th series of DIY SOS - Independence for Isla - had everything. Laughter - a shower than speaks French - tears, struggle, determination and victory. It was gritty, grimy, tough and soft in the middle.

The premise of DIY SOS is that a team of builders arrive at a house somewhere in the UK on a rescue mission-to transform the premises and make them fit purpose.

Isla was born with a rare genetic disorder, mandibuloacral dysplasia, which makes her bones brittle and causes her major organs to age prematurely.
